NAME
       iconv_ko - codeset conversion for Korean encodings

DESCRIPTION
       The  table below provides basic information on available Korean codeset
       code conversions.


       The listed names in the table are canonical names. There  are  aliases,
       e.g., Wansung, eucKR, and such for EUC-KR, that are also supported. For
       the supported aliases, please refer to "iconv -l" output.

       tab()  box; lw(0.61i) |lw(4.89i) lw(0.61i) |lw(4.89i) Code SetsDescrip‐
       tion _ EUC-KRT{ Korean Extended UNIX Code  representation  using  KS  X
       1003  or  US-ASCII  as the primary single byte codeset and KS X 1001 as
       the supplementary two-byte codeset. Also known as Wansung  and  Comple‐
       tion code.  T} _ IBM-933T{ IBM EBCDIC mixed multibyte code page for Ko‐
       rean.  T} _ ISO-2022-KRT{ Korean 7-bit encoded codeset based on ISO/IEC
       2022  extension  mechanism and as specified in the RFC 1557. Can repre‐
       sent characters of KS X 1003 or US-ASCII and KS X 1001 character  sets.
       T}  _ JOHAP82T{ Korean multibyte codeset using KS X 1003 or US-ASCII as
       the single byte sub-codeset and KS C 5601-1987 Annex  3:  Supplementary
       Code  System (2 Byte Johap Code System) as the double-byte sub-codeset.
       Also known as Packed and old Combination code.  T} _  JOHAP92T{  Korean
       multibyte  codeset  using KS X 1003 or US-ASCII as the single byte sub-
       codeset and KS X 1001 Annex 3: Supplementary Code System (2 Byte  Johap
       Code  System) as the double-byte sub-codeset. Also known as Combination
       and Combination code.  T} _ CP949T{ Windows code page  949  for  Korean
       extends EUC-KR by including pre-composed 8,822 modern day Hangul sylla‐
       bles  that are not present in the KS X 1001 pre-composed Hangul blocks.
       Also known as Unified Hangul code.  T} _ N-BYTET{ Korean 7-bit encoding
       for Hangul and KS X 1003 or US-ASCII characters as specified in the  KS
       X  1001  Annex  4: 7 Bit Hangul Alphabet codes. Do not include Hanja or
       special symbols.  T}



       For any characters that exist and are valid in fromcode that do not ex‐
       ist in tocode of any of the above codesets,  each  of  such  characters
       will  be  converted into '?' (0x3f) as a non-identical code conversion.
       If the tocode is a Unicode  encoding,  U+FFFD  (replacement  character)
       will be used instead.

NOTES
       Available iconv and cconv code conversions related to  Korean  codesets
       and their aliases can be obtained by running "iconv -l" as described in
       the iconv(1) manual page.


       Selected cconv code conversions related to Korean codesets also support
       the following variations based on the Unihan database:

       level 1:    kSimplifiedVariant


       level 2:    kTraditionalVariant


       level 3:    kSemanticVariant


       level 4:    kZVariant


       level 5:    kCompatibilityVariant


       level 6:    kSpecializedSemanticVariant



       The  conversions  supporting these variant levels are: EUC-KR, IBM-933,
       ISO-2022-KR, JOHAP92 and CP949.
